Feed Palatability Enhancers Market Analysis
The Feed Palatability Enhancers Market size is estimated at USD 3.57 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ach USD 4.75 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 5.90% during the forecast period (2025-2030).
The market is experiencing growth driven by increasing consumer awareness and demand for high-quality meat products. Regulatory bodies, including the US Food and Drug Administration (USFDA) and European Food Safety Authority, have implemented strict quality standards for food products delivered to consumers. Feed additives often impart a bitter taste to animal feed, which feed flavors and sweeteners help neutralize while improving palatability and increasing feed intake. The demand for these feed additives is rapidly increasing in countries such as China, India, and Brazil due to rising meat consumption. According to USDA, Brazil's beef consumption increased from 7.66 million metric tons in 2023 to 8.04 million metric tons in 2024, showing a 5 percent growth.
The United States FDA (Food and Drug Administration) identifies meat composition, fat content, color, flavor, and protein content as key quality indicators. To meet these standards and maintain healthy livestock, husbandries, and commercial farms require effective palatability-enhancing feed ingredients. This demand creates opportunities for feed flavors and sweetener manufacturers. Additionally, rising household income levels have increased the consumption of processed meat and protein-rich diets, driving the demand for animal feed. These factors indicate substantial market growth potential during the forecast period.
Feed Palatability Enhancers Market Trends
Rapidly Growing Poultry Sector is Boosting the Market
The global demand for poultry meat and eggs continues to rise, driven by their nutritional value, affordability, and protein content, which has consequently resulted in higher global poultry production. This growth is evidenced by USDA data, which reports that global chicken meat production in Marketing Year 2023-2024 reached 103.83 million metric tons, marking a 2% increase from the previous year's 102.2 million metric tons. Unlike ruminants or swine, poultry requires high-quality, palatable feed to optimize production within its shorter growth cycles. The production efficiency is particularly notable in laying hens, which, according to Poultry Site, have varying productive lifespans depending on the system employed: 78-80 weeks in a one-cycle system, 102-106 weeks in a two-cycle system, and 140-150 weeks in a three-cycle system.
The growth in egg consumption across developing countries such as India, Indonesia, and Brazil has significantly increased the demand for feed palatability enhancers and modifiers among poultry farmers. This trend is particularly evident in India, which maintains its position as the second-largest egg producer globally, achieving a production volume of 38.38 billion eggs in 2022-23, as reported by the Ministry of Fisheries, Animal Husbandry & Dairying. Given these developments in poultry population growth and the subsequent increase in feed requirements, the market is anticipated to experience substantial growth during the forecast period.

Asia-Pacific Dominates the Market
Cattle and pigs demonstrate a strong preference for sweet substances due to their abundant taste buds, which influences their feeding behavior and dietary preferences. This natural inclination has been validated through research in China, where studies revealed that weaned piglets prefer diets supplemented with sucralose, with dietary supplementation of 150 mg/kg sucralose significantly increasing feed intake. The Chinese animal feed additive industry's development is closely intertwined with government regulations, as evidenced by the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s (MARA)'s 2023 approval of two new feed additives, four feed ingredients, and modifications to the feed additives and ingredients catalogs. These regulatory changes, combined with the country's ongoing modernization efforts in agricultural practices and the rising demand for meat products to meet the protein requirements of its growing population, are collectively driving market growth in the region.
India's dominant position as the world's largest producer and consumer of milk, including buffalo milk, has significant implications for the feed palatability enhancer market. This leadership is reflected in the National Dairy Development Board (NDDB) data, which shows India's milk production reaching 239.3 million metric tons in FY 2023-2024, marking an increase from 230.6 million metric tons in the previous year. To sustain this substantial domestic demand, the focus has shifted toward improving animal productivity through enhanced feed intake. This agricultural objective has created a ripple effect in the feed additive industry, particularly driving the demand for feed palatability enhancers that can effectively minimize feed bitterness while ensuring proper animal nutrition.
Feed Palatability Enhancers Industry Overview
The feed palatability enhancers market is consolidated, with prominent companies including Associated British Foods plc (ABF), Kemin Industries, Inc., Kerry Group plc, Symrise AG, and Adisseo France SAS. These companies primarily focus on mergers and acquisitions, while also engaging in collaborations to develop new products and enhance research capabilities.

Feed Palatability Enhancers Market News
- January 2024: Phytobiotics Futterzusatzstoffe GmbH introduced 9 smart flavors formulated to enhance livestock feed palatability. These additions aim to address specific taste preferences of different farm animals while improving animal health and production efficiency.
- September 2023: Symrise opened a pet food palatants facility in Chapéco, Brazil. The plant produces palatants for cat and dog food. With 10,000 square meters of infrastructure, the facility is Latin America's largest and Symrise's biggest site for pet food ingredients worldwide.
Feed Palatability Enhancers Industry Segmentation
Feed palatability enhancers improve feed intake by enhancing taste, aroma, and texture, making feed more appealing to animals. The feed palatability enhancers market segments include type (flavors, sweeteners, and aroma enhancers), animal type (ruminant, poultry, swine, aquaculture, and other animal types), and geography (North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, South America, and Africa).
